Abstract
How many diverse faces can Africa show a stranger passing by? A hundred? A thousand? An infinite number, no doubt. Many more, anyway, than what photographer may hope to grasp, despite his best endeavors. The hundred odd glimpses shared in this pages will surely trigger the reader's desire to see and learn more. Here is an invitation au voyage to some fifteen Africans countries, to get acquainted with the men, women, elders and children through the expressions Eric Sellato has so eloquently caught. All these faces set in delight or sorrow, in pride or uncertainty, in kindness or security, tell us about Africa and about ourselves.
